Output 652a5523ad379b5460503d8bb840c6d734f32e0b55b8c4cb3bd3cd2db68573bf:9

value
21739211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13d8fc5d84570761c78280afaf3c892ebd9dbcb3 OP_EQUAL
address
M9i71WhHqNhoEL9R7vAGyTYk7gqsU6nqWg
transaction
652a5523ad379b5460503d8bb840c6d734f32e0b55b8c4cb3bd3cd2db68573bf
spent
true